About Georges Huez

Georges Huez is a scholar working on Molecular Biology, Immunology, Oncology, Cardiology and Cardiovascular Medicine and Genetics, having authored 46 papers that have together received 2.6k indexed citations. Recurring topics across this work include RNA Research and Splicing (17 papers), RNA and protein synthesis mechanisms (14 papers), Cytokine Signaling Pathways and Interactions (9 papers), RNA modifications and cancer (9 papers), interferon and immune responses (7 papers), Viral Infections and Immunology Research (6 papers), RNA Interference and Gene Delivery (5 papers) and RNA regulation and disease (5 papers). The work is most often cited by research in Immunology (766 citations), Molecular Biology (1.7k citations), Oncology (399 citations), Cancer Research (203 citations) and Cardiology and Cardiovascular Medicine (213 citations). Georges Huez has collaborated with scholars based in Belgium, France and United States. Frequent co-authors include Véronique Kruys, Marc Wathelet, Cyril Gueydan, Daniel Caput, I. Clauss, Gérard Marbaix, Hubert Chantrenne, Louis Droogmans, Tong Zhang and Jean Content. Their work appears in journals such as European Journal of Biochemistry, Journal of Biological Chemistry, FEBS Letters, Biochemical and Biophysical Research Communications and Oncogene.
